Onboard a Kubernetes Cluster to Azure Arc
Arc-enabled Kubernetes provides centralized management, governance, and security of hybrid and multi-cloud Kubernetes clusters. In this hands-on lab, you will onboard an existing Kubernetes cluster to Azure Arc, configure Entra Authorization, and enable Cluster Connect capabilities.

Challenge
Connect a Kubernetes Cluster to Azure Arc
-
Connect the single node k3s cluster running on
LinuxVM
to Azure Arc using the Azure CLI onLinuxVM
.Note: k3s has been installed on the virtual machine, and
kubectl
installed by k3s will automatically use thekubeconfig
file located at/etc/rancher/k3s/k3s.yaml
.Note: By default, only the root user has access to read the
kubeconfig
file. You can grant thecloud_user
account access to thekubeconfig
file using the commands listed below:sudo groupadd k3s sudo usermod -a -G k3s cloud_user sudo chown root:k3s /etc/rancher/k3s/k3s.yaml sudo chmod 740 /etc/rancher/k3s/k3s.yaml
-
Log out and back in again for your group membership to be updated.
exit ssh cloud_user@<LinuxVM Public IP>
